What Are Casement Windows?
Casement windows are depended upon one side and open outside, generally run with a crank system. They are available in different sizes and materials, including wood, vinyl, and aluminum. The design enables optimum ventilation and unblocked views, making them a favorite choice for lots of homeowners.
Characteristics of Casement Windows
| Function | Information |
|---|---|
| Opening Mechanism | Hinged on the side, opening outside |
| Operation | Usually operated through a hand crank |
| Ventilation | Offers outstanding air flow, can be completely opened |
| Security | Secure locking systems, difficult to require open |
| Energy Efficiency | Can be fitted with energy-efficient glass |
| Installation Style | Suitable for various architectural designs consisting of modern and conventional |

Installation Considerations
While casement windows offer numerous benefits, a few installation factors to consider should be considered:
1. Space Requirements
Casement windows open external, needing appropriate space exterior. Homeowners ought to make sure there are no obstructions like shrubs or fences that might impede their opening.
2. Climate condition
In locations with high winds, casement windows may require to be developed with more powerful materials and locking mechanisms to withstand the components.
3. Maintenance
While casement windows are low-maintenance, the hardware parts might need occasional lubrication to make sure smooth operation. Homeowners should also know that dirt and particles can collect in the hinges and crank systems.
4. Cost
The cost of setting up casement windows can differ based on the size, products utilized, and labor expenses. Property owners need to get numerous quotes and consider their budget plan before continuing.
Common Materials for Casement Windows
When selecting casement windows, homeowners can choose from different products, each with its benefits and drawbacks:
| Material |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Wood | Aesthetic appeal, adjustable surfaces | Requires regular maintenance to avoid rot |
| Vinyl | Low-maintenance, energy-efficient | Limited color choices, might not match all designs |
| Aluminum | Durable, lightweight, and resistant to rust | Can perform heat, resulting in possible energy loss |
| Fiberglass | Extremely long lasting, energy-efficient, and low maintenance | Generally higher preliminary costs |
Maintenance Tips for Casement Windows
To maximize the longevity and efficiency of casement windows, property owners need to embrace the following maintenance practices: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ean the glass and frame regularly to avoid dirt accumulation and keep clearness.
- Lubricate Moving Parts: Apply lube to the hinges, cranks, and locks annually to guarantee smooth operation.
- Examine Seals: Inspect weather removing and seals for wear and change them as required to prevent air leakages.
- Inspect for Damage: Regularly check the frames for any indications of deterioration or damage, specifically in wood windows.
- Test Operation: Periodically open and close the windows to ensure they are operating properly and not stuck.
